What is the brief history of media?

Although the term ‘media’ came into use only in the 1920s to denote the structures of such communication, media history takes account of the period at least from the advent of the handpress in the fifteenth century, and some interpretations include the scriptoria, oral traditions, and wall paintings of medieval times.

When was mass media started?

It was coined in the 1920s (with the advent of nationwide radio networks, mass-circulation newspapers and magazines), although mass media was present centuries before the term became commom.

How do you write an introduction to the media?

Writing an intro News journalists call the first sentence of a story the ‘intro’, or introduction. The first sentence should summarise the story ‘in a nutshell’ and cover key information. At least three of the six classic questions (5 Ws and 1 H) – Who, What, Where, When, Why and How – should be answered in the intro.

What are the different eras of media history?

According to Campbell, Martin, and Fabos (2007), the history of media can be traced through five main eras that of oral, written, print, electronic, and digital.
